Output 15caf313e56cea11b988ce95106fa33239b66e95610308e17924b7dcef449c3b:0

value
27560752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5e02b099d7383a377c60db6fff7341856c21f7 OP_EQUAL
address
MVdXg3sjrQbecvqviq5nGjDozXUjK1R8QH
transaction
15caf313e56cea11b988ce95106fa33239b66e95610308e17924b7dcef449c3b
spent
true